Senior Manager, Marketing Operations & Technology (REMOTE)
Charles River Laboratories
Job Description
Job Overview
As Senior Manager, Marketing Operations & Technology, you will architect and scale the data foundation that powers our marketing strategy. This role defines how we measure performance, understand customer engagement, and activate growth with confidence.
Role
This is a high-impact, highly visible role with direct influence on how Marketing and Sales operate, measure success, and drive growth. You will partner closely with Marketing, Sales Operations, Finance, IT, and Data Science to:
- Orchestrate the end-to-end revenue funnel (inquiry through renewal/expansion)
- Build a scalable, future‑ready data and analytics foundation
- Deliver actionable insights that shape executive decision‑making
- Standardize measurement, campaign execution, and experimentation
Key Responsibilities
Marketing Performance Analytics & Revenue Insights
- Define KPI frameworks across funnel health, pipeline velocity, marketing contribution, and revenue performance
- Build the analytical foundation for planning, forecasting, and executive decision‑making
- Identify ICPs, buying behaviors, and reactivation opportunities to inform growth strategies
- Deliver actionable insights that shape strategy and executive narratives
- Quantify funnel friction and its impact on conversion, velocity, and revenue
Data Modeling, BI & Analytics Delivery
- Partner with IT and Data teams to define data requirements and validate models aligned to business processes
- Architect and deliver scalable Power BI dashboards and data models
- Ensure accuracy, consistency, and governance of enterprise reporting
- Lead advanced and ad‑hoc analyses to inform key business decisions
Cross‑Functional Partnership & Data Alignment
- Align Marketing, Sales Ops, Finance, and IT on KPI definitions, funnel metrics, and reporting frameworks
- Integrate product, regional, and channel data into unified views of performance
- Serve as Marketing stakeholder for data governance, compliance, and system integrations
- Influence lead management measurement, data quality standards, and platform decisions
AI, Experimentation & Advanced Analytics
- Identify and scale opportunities in predictive analytics, segmentation, and automated insight generation
- Apply test‑and‑learn methodologies (A/B, MVT) to drive continuous optimization
- Build a scalable, AI‑ready analytics foundation aligned to future growth
Governance, Adoption & Continuous Improvement
- Establish and maintain KPI definitions, taxonomies, and reporting standards
- Drive documentation, governance practices, and adoption of analytics frameworks
- Lead change enablement efforts (training, communication, adoption tracking)
- Champion a culture of data quality, transparency, and continuous improvement
Job Qualifications
Required Qualifications
- Bachelor’s degree in Marketing, Business, Applied Data Analytics, or related field
- 7–10+ years in marketing analytics, operations, or revenue insights roles architecting and analyzing complex B2B datasets
- Advanced expertise in:
- Power BI (data modeling, DAX, dashboard development)
- SQL for data validation, transformation, and analysis
- Predictive modeling and statistical analysis
- Proven track record building KPI frameworks, funnel analytics, pipeline modeling, and revenue reporting at scale
- Hands‑on experience integrating data across marketing, sales, and finance systems (e.g., Salesforce, marketing automation, ERP)
- Demonstrated ability to translate complex data into actionable insights and executive‑level recommendations
- Experience leading cross‑functional alignment across Marketing, Sales Ops, Finance, and IT
Preferred Qualifications & Expertise
- MBA or advanced degree in data analytics
- Background in CRO, life sciences, or healthcare environments preferred
- Deep understanding of B2B commercial models, including funnel dynamics, pipeline velocity, and multi‑product environments
- Strong grasp of martech architecture, data modeling, and system integration best practices
- Experience establishing experimentation programs and measurement frameworks (A/B, MVT, attribution, incrementality)
- Exposure to enterprise‑scale initiatives (e.g., platform transformations, global standardization, data modernization)
- Familiarity with marketing and data ecosystems (e.g., CDP, GA4, GTM, ABM/intent platforms)
- Working knowledge of data privacy regulations (e.g., GDPR, CCPA) and compliant measurement approaches
Compensation Data
The pay range for this position in the USA is $103K - $145K USD. Salaries vary within the range based on factors including, but not limited to, experience, skills, education, certifications, location, and any collective agreements, if applicable. Remote candidates located outside the USA should be aware that the relevant pay range varies by country and location.
